These cards were pretty quick and simple to make using all three of the Panda images and also all three of the sentiments. Obviously, you can mix and match the sentiment with the image you prefer. 
Each envelope was stamped to co-ordinate with the card and I also added a semi circle of Picture Perfect Party Designer Series Paper to the outside flap of the envelopes.
Once I’d finished making the cards, I also made a box to keep them in.

The box itself was made using Thick Whisper White cardstock and the Lots to Love Box Framelits Dies. You need to use the die twice to make the front and back pieces. Remember to glue the pieces together so that there is a flap at each end (assuming you want to flaps). Also, be sure to fold and burnish the flaps before you glue the box together. This makes it much easier to tuck the flaps in once the box is made up.
The finished box measures 12.4 x 7.6 x 1.6 cm. Just perfect for the cards and their envelopes. In fact, you can fit more than three of each in the box. But, much depends on whether you have added any thing to the front of the cards. My cards are flat so you could easily fit five in.
For the front of the box I stamped the panda with the balloon (onto a piece of 7.0 x 10.0 cm piece of Whisper White) and used my Bermuda Bay Stampin’ Blends to colour the balloon. I then re-stamped the balloon two more times onto some scrap paper and coloured them using the Pool Party and Bermuda Bay Stampin’ Blends. 
I also used my Colour Lifter to add the highlights on each of the balloons.  The two extra balloons were then cut out and added to the image using Stampin’ Dimensionals and the strings were added using a Stampin’ Write Marker (before I added the balloons).
